  2. I recently bought a 996 C4. As Dan says, it's an experience i felt i had to tick off my list, and im glad i have done, but honestly i'd rather have my old 350z back. Whilst the Porsche is certainly rapid and interesting to drive, i dont feel like it's really that much more special. Also the 'Porsche Anxiety' is pretty annoying... every little noise has me worrying that it's going to cost me some serious money. I've never really been concerned with a cars running costs before, but these are expensive to keep maintained well... and it's money that i dont see as being very good value (i.e. on other cars, preventative maintenance is almost rewarding but on the Porsche i feel like im getting ripped off).

  16. So after a week of ownership, i was feeling pretty fed up with the Porsche! It was an absolute chore to drive and i soon realised why... its because of the tinted windows! It had limo tints all round and in day light you struggled to see, but at night you couldnt see anything at all. It was awful! I even resorted to driving with my windows down just so i could see in my wing mirrors! So today i went out and peeled the tints off all round! it took less than 10 minutes and was SERIOUSLY satisfying to do! I've just been out for a spin tonight and it's sooo much nicer to drive.
